Collision Sensors Market Summary

As per MRFR analysis, the Collision Sensors Market was estimated at 3.86 USD Billion in 2024. The Collision Sensors industry is projected to grow from 4.147 USD Billion in 2025 to 8.491 USD Bill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.43 during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

Key Market Trends & Highlights

The Collision Sensors Market is poised for substantial growth driven by technological advancements and increasing safety regulations.

  • North America remains the largest market for collision sensors, driven by stringent safety regulations and consumer demand for advanced vehicle safety features.
  • The Asia-Pacific region is emerging as the fastest-growing market, fueled by rapid urbanization and increasing investments in automotive technology.
  • Ultrasonic sensors dominate the market due to their widespread application in commercial vehicles, while Lidar sensors are gaining traction as the fastest-growing segment in automated vehicles.
  • Rising demand for vehicle safety features and government regulations are key drivers propelling the growth of the collision sensors market.

Market Size & Forecast

2024 Market Size 3.86 (USD Billion)
2035 Market Size 8.491 (USD Billion)
CAGR (2025 - 2035) 7.43%

By Technology: Ultrasonic Sensors (Largest) vs. Lidar Sensors (Fastest-Growing)

In the Collision Sensors Market, Ultrasonic Sensors currently lead in market share due to their widespread use in various applications, particularly in parking assistance and low-speed collision avoidance systems. These sensors are favored for their cost-effectiveness, ease of integration, and reliability in detecting obstacles. Lidar Sensors, while representing a smaller portion of the market, are rapidly gaining traction due to advancements in technology and increasing demand for high-precision sensing solutions, essential in autonomous driving applications. The growth trend within this segment is significantly influenced by the rise of vehicle automation and smart technology integration. Factors such as increased focus on safety standards, innovations in sensor technology, and consumer demand for enhanced driving assistance systems are propelling the adoption of both Ultrasonic and Lidar Sensors. The market is witnessing a shift where Lidar's precision and comprehensive environmental mapping capabilities are becoming crucial for newer vehicle models, making it the fastest-growing segment in the collision sensors landscape.

Ultrasonic Sensors (Dominant) vs. Camera-Based Sensors (Emerging)

Ultrasonic Sensors, as the dominant technology in the Collision Sensors Market, are widely implemented in various automotive applications, particularly for proximity detection and obstacle avoidance at lower speeds. Their operational simplicity and effectiveness in short-range detection make them a preferred choice for vehicle manufacturers and consumers alike. Conversely, Camera-Based Sensors are an emerging technology that leverages advanced imaging processing algorithms to interpret the vehicle's surroundings. Although still gaining acceptance compared to Ultrasonic Sensors, these systems offer enhanced functionality by recognizing traffic signs, pedestrians, and lane boundaries, thereby contributing to comprehensive driver-assistance features. The integration of cameras with other sensors is enhancing their market appeal, indicating a growing trend towards the convergence of technologies in collision avoidance systems.

Front Sensors (Dominant) vs. Side Sensors (Emerging)

Front sensors are currently the dominant force in the collision sensors market, characterized by their wide adoption in vehicles designed for safety and collision avoidance. These sensors utilize technology such as radar and LIDAR to detect obstacles ahead, playing a crucial role in systems like automatic braking and adaptive cruise control. As the automotive industry shifts toward greater regulatory compliance regarding safety features, front sensors become essential in enhancing driver security. Conversely, side sensors represent an emerging segment, offering innovative solutions that focus on lateral awareness and collision prevention during maneuvers like lane changes or parking. Their integration into vehicles supports a more holistic safety approach, with manufacturers increasingly investing in their development to meet consumer preferences for comprehensive safety systems. Together, these segments illustrate the diversity and evolving nature of collision sensor technologies.

Regional Insights

The Regional analysis of the Collision Sensors Market highlights significant variations in market value and growth potential across different areas. In 2024, North America leads with a valuation of 1.55 USD Billion, and is projected to grow to 3.44 USD Billion by 2035, showcasing its majority holding and strong demand for advanced safety systems in vehicles. Europe follows with a valuation of 1.2 USD Billion in 2024, and is expected to rise to 2.67 USD Billion by 2035, supported by stringent regulatory standards promoting the adoption of collision sensors.

The APAC region, valued at 0.95 USD Billion in 2024 and anticipated to grow to 2.12 USD Billion by 2035, indicates increasing automotive production and consumer awareness of safety features. South America and MEA, with values of 0.1 USD Billion and 0.06 USD Billion in 2024, respectively, are smaller markets but have potential for growth as market players focus on expanding their footprint in these regions. Overall, the Global Collision Sensors Market data illustrates that North America and Europe dominate due to technological advancements and regulatory pushes, while APAC shows significant growth prospects owing to rising automotive manufacturing.
